										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="font-weight: 400">After investing time and care into a professional hair removal service, the period after that matters as much as the treatment itself. What you avoid doing in the days immediately after your session can protect results and maintain the appearance of treated skin.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Post-treatment discipline is overlooked, yet it plays an important role in how smooth, calm, and even the skin looks moving forward. In this article, we will focus on actions to avoid strictly after getting hair removal services. Read on!</span></p>
<h2><strong>Do Not Expose Treated Skin to Direct Heat</strong></h2>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Heat exposure is one of the most common mistakes people make after getting a </span><strong><a href="https://optimalhealthandwellness.biz/hair-removal" target="_blank" rel="noopener">hair removal service</a></strong><span style="font-weight: 400">. Hot showers, steam rooms, saunas, and prolonged sun exposure are treated as harmless daily habits, but they should not be part of the immediate post-treatment routine.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Treated skin needs calm conditions, not extremes. Introducing heat too early can disturb the surface and interfere with how the skin settles after the session. </span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Avoiding heat means more than staying out of the sun. It also includes avoiding heating pads, hot baths, and even standing too close to direct heat sources in enclosed spaces. Skin that has recently undergone hair removal benefits from stable, moderate conditions.</span></p>
<h2><strong>Don’t Go for Microneedling</strong></h2>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Combining cosmetic procedures without proper spacing is a mistake that compromises results. Scheduling </span><strong><a href="https://indulgencecosmetics.com/treatments/skincare-rejuvenation-treatments-at-indulgence-cosmetics/microneedling/" target="_blank" rel="noopener">microneedling</a></strong><span style="font-weight: 400"> too soon after hair removal places unnecessary stress on the skin. Each treatment serves a different purpose and demands its own recovery time.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Layering procedures back-to-back does not enhance results. Instead, it overwhelms the skin with multiple interventions in a short timeframe. Even if both treatments are part of a long-term aesthetic plan, they should not overlap during the immediate post-treatment period.</span></p>
<h2><strong>Do Not Use Harsh Skincare Products</strong></h2>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Immediately after hair removal is not the time to experiment with strong skincare formulas. Products that contain acids or concentrated fragrances should be avoided. Even products that are part of a regular routine can become unsuitable during this time.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Resisting the urge to cleanse aggressively or apply corrective treatments protects the skin’s surface. Scrubs, chemical peels, and polishing cleansers introduce unnecessary stress. The skin responds best when it is left undisturbed and free from external stimulation.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">This includes over-cleansing. Washing too frequently or using foaming cleansers with strong surfactants can reduce comfort of the skin. A minimal approach works best during this phase. Gentle cleansing at normal intervals maintains cleanliness without interference.</span></p>
<h2><strong>Do Not Resume Intense Physical Activity</strong></h2>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Returning to high-intensity workouts too soon after hair removal is a common mistake. Activities that cause excessive sweating, friction, or prolonged skin contact should be postponed. Gyms, long runs, cycling, and contact sports place additional stress on the skin that are best avoided right after treatment.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Sweat creates a moist environment that is not ideal for recently <a href="https://inkitter.com/pos-systems-tailored-to-the-bar-and-beauty-salon-industries/" target="_blank" rel="noopener"><strong>treated skin</strong></a>. Combined with tight athletic wear, it increases contact and warmth in the area. This combination works against the calm conditions the skin benefits from after a session.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Stretching routines and yoga poses that press the body against mats or equipment also count as physical stressors. Even if the movement feels light, the repeated contact can irritate the treated surface.</span></p>
